Guangzhou Xingpai Edges Meizhou Qiangmin in CFA Member Association Champions League Clash
A tightly contested fixture in the Chinese Football Association Member Association Champions League saw Guangzhou Xingpai secure a valuable 2-1 away victory over Meizhou Qiangmin on April 21, 2026. The match, kicking off at 16:00 local time, provided an exciting glimpse into the competitive depth of China's lower-tier football pyramid, with the visitors ultimately proving more clinical in front of goal.
